Famous and beloved compositions by the “King of Waltz”, Johann Strauss II, as well as arias of operas by W. A. Mozart in the wonderful atmosphere of Vienna's Imperial Palace (Hofburg), create a magical evening in Vienna.



The orchestra consists of about 40 professional musician and international soloist of the Vienna State Opera. Founded 30 years ago, the orchestra still delights with its waltz and operetta pieces. Enjoy a concert in the music capital of the world.



It was at the celebratory inauguration concert on 19 October 1913, in the presence of Emperor Franz Joseph I, that opened the world to new things: Richard Strauss created his Festive Prelude op. 61 for this occasion, and it was followed by Ludwig van Beethoven‘s Ninth Symphony. Awareness of tradition and enthusiasm for innovation are today still the main pillars of the musical world of the Konzerthaus, forming its artistic identity. For this very reason, the Vienna Hofburg Orchestra decided to return to the place where it was founded to play the Mozart-Saal, which has gained a worldwide reputation for its unique acoustics.
